Description

Kumquat belongs to Rutaceae (Rutaceae), a fine variety of the citrus subfamily Kumquat. Small evergreen trees or shrubs with broad-lanceolate or broad-elliptic leaves, thorny stems and branches, fruit obovate-elliptic, smooth, golden skin, small and dense oil cells, edible. The kumquat peel is tender and crisp, and the fragrance of the oil sprayed when the skin is bitten is stimulating. Among them, Huapi kumquat is a new kumquat variety that was discovered and successfully selected by agricultural scientists in Rong'an County, Guangxi in 1981 in Dajiang Town. The cultivation began in 1984. After more than 20 years of cultivation observation, this variety has stable traits, good yield, good quality, and easy to cultivate, but it has more pests than ordinary kumquats. Therefore, kumquat is one of the famous agricultural and sideline products in Rong'an.
